Mikulski, Cardin Fight For Maryland's Fair Share to Re-equip National Guard 5/22/2007
The National Guard is funded as a national program, with state allocations coming from the Guard Bureau. Senator Mikulski, a member of the Defense Appropriations Subcommittee, has pledged to fight to increase national funding for the Guard in the fiscal year 2008 Defense spending bill. Earlier this month, she asked Defense Secretary Robert Gates to amend the Department of Defense's 2008 request to add the $5.1 billion the Guard says it needs to fill their equipment shortfall for this year.

Mikulski-Warner Bill Gives Small Businesses Critical Guest Worker Extension 3/28/2007
Bill extends H2B visa cap exemption by five years WASHINGTON, D.C. - Senators Barbara A. Mikulski (D-Md.) and John Warner (R-Va.) today announced they have reintroduced their bill to provide a five-year extension to a crucial provision from her Save Our Small and Seasonal Businesses Act that protects small and seasonal businesses from a devastating cut to their workforce. A last-minute, one-year extension was included as part of the 2007 Department of Defense authorization bill in the 109th Congress, but it expires on September 30, 2007.
